What is Microlearning?

Microlearning refers to an instructional approach that delivers educational content in short, focused bursts—typically ranging ‌from two to ten⁢ minutes. Leveraging digital platforms, microlearning modules are​ designed for accessibility, just-in-time delivery, and high retention. Key characteristics‍ include:

  • Brief⁤ and targeted lessons
  • Interactivity and multimedia integration (videos,quizzes,infographics)
  • Mobile-amiable and on-demand access
  • Self-paced progression

Traditional Methods in Education

Traditional instructional methods include teacher-lead classroom lectures,textbooks,structured assignments,and examinations. These conventional​ approaches emphasize:

  • Longer, uninterrupted study ⁣sessions
  • In-person interactions and group discussions
  • Linear, curriculum-based progressions
  • Periodic assessment and feedback cycles

‌ ⁢ ‍ ‌⁣ Despite the emergence of microlearning, traditional methods remain foundational for many disciplines—especially were deeper critical thinking, collaboration, ⁤and theoretical comprehension are required.

Microlearning vs. Traditional Methods: A Comparative Overview

Feature Microlearning Traditional Methods
Lesson Length 2–10 minutes per module 45–90 ⁢minutes per session
Learning Mode Self-paced, ​mobile, ‌digital Instructor-led, in-person/on-site
Content Format Videos, quizzes, flashcards Books, lectures, group work
Assessment Immediate, formative Periodic, summative
Student Engagement High (interactive, gamified elements) Varies (often passive participation)
Accessibility Anytime, anywhere Depends on location/schedule

How Student Preferences⁤ Are Shaping Education

‌ ⁤ Today’s⁣ students are digital natives, accustomed to instant information and seamless⁣ connectivity.Recent research and surveys⁢ highlight ⁣key trends driving the shift:

  • Adaptability: ⁢Students value the ability to learn ⁢on their own terms, fitting lessons around busy schedules.
  • Personalization: Tailored content that addresses individual strengths and‍ weaknesses is in high demand.
  • Interactivity: Gamified elements, quizzes, and multimedia ⁤make learning more engaging.
  • Short Attention Spans: Microlearning’s brevity aligns with the average modern attention span, boosting knowledge retention.
  • On-Demand Access: Students‌ prefer platforms‌ offering content​ accessible from any device, at‍ any time.

Educational institutions and EdTech companies are responding by integrating microlearning components ⁢into existing⁢ curricula. This hybrid approach acknowledges‌ evolving preferences while preserving ​the advantages of both systems.

The benefits of Microlearning

  • Improved Engagement: Short, interactive ‍modules prevent cognitive overload and keep students​ motivated.
  • Faster Learning: Focused​ content enables quicker understanding and application of concepts.
  • Higher Retention Rates: Regular, spaced repetition of micro-content supports long-term memory.
  • Easy Accessibility: Students can learn anytime, anywhere—ideal for remote education and mobile learning.
  • Cost Effectiveness: Microlearning reduces ⁤production ⁤costs and​ resources compared to full-length courses.

When Are ‍Traditional Methods Still Most Effective?

While microlearning offers remarkable flexibility and efficiency, traditional methods ⁤remain indispensable in scenarios such as:

  • Complex Subjects: Topics that require deep, nuanced exploration (e.g., philosophy, advanced​ sciences, medical studies)
  • Collaborative projects: In-person teamwork and experiential learning foster social ⁣and emotional skills
  • Personal Mentorship: Direct feedback from teachers and real-time discussions nurture ⁣critical thinking
  • Certification & Accreditation: ⁢ Standardized assessments and rigorous curricula are often essential for ​degree ⁤programs

Practical Tips: Implementing Microlearning in Education

  • Start Small: Convert ⁤supplemental materials,like summaries ⁣or review quizzes,into microlearning modules.
  • Leverage Technology: use learning platforms or apps designed for micro-content⁢ delivery, such as‌ Kahoot or Quizlet.
  • Engage Multiple senses: ⁢Incorporate‌ videos,animations,and interactive exercises to appeal to diverse learning styles.
  • Track Progress: Use analytics‍ to monitor student engagement and adapt‌ content for improved outcomes.
  • Blend with ‌Traditional Methods: ‍ Microlearning works⁢ best when‌ integrated thoughtfully within broader ⁢educational frameworks.
